I always keep that finger touching the line when I'm working a jig or bait back in. I can feel that tiny take of the fish quicker than through the rod's handle. By the way , I'm really starting to like this Hi-Vis line. I caught almost all my fish today using it! Didn't scare any of them away.

I like the high vis yellow 6lb spider wire braid. I dont notice any difference in hits from the braid or the clear mono setup. ive even used this as a leader for my 3wt flyrod and caught my two largest gills.
Comment by Joe Angelucci on September 14, 2013 at 3:20pm

Hi Vis is great when fishing fixed line since it's very easy to see the takes.My experience is that Bluegill do not appear to be Hi Viz line shy when using 4lb test or less. I use it when dapping dry flies at about 10 -12 feet. Asso makes a very nice white / blue Fluorolight line. The line is perfect for low light applications.
